Terminal blocks and barrier blocks are both common, advanced electrical interconnection systems that are used in industrial, commercial and residential settings. Terminal blocks are designed to interface multiple sources of energy, such as electrical current, voltage or ground with a common electrical component, such as a capacitor or relay. The terminal blocks provide insulation to ensure the circuits they are connected to do not interact with each other in an unsafe or hazardous manner. They also provide the link between the two circuits so that any changes made to the first will be transferred to the second and vice versa.

Barrier blocks, on the other hand, are designed to protect and contain several connection points within an electrical circuit. These connection points can include power, voltage, ground, and other electrical connections in order to make electrical systems more complex. The barrier blocks are also designed to isolate a circuit from the rest of the electrical system, thus protecting it from interference or harm. They are commonly used to eliminate the need for large numbers of sockets, wires and connections, making them ideal for tightly spaced installations. They are also particularly popular in mobile applications such as automotive and marine applications due to their portability.

In the industrial arena, both terminal blocks and barrier blocks are commonly used for a multitude of tasks. They are highly beneficial in regards to efficiency, cost savings and safety. Terminal blocks are used to provide power to multiple points from a single source or to distribute power from multiple points to one load. They can also be used to connect different series of devices, such as resistors and capacitors. The common terminals can also be used to create a circuit that provides protection from overvoltage, overcurrent, and other detrimental conditions.

Barrier blocks, meanwhile, are used to easily interconnect multiple circuits, to group electrical components for easier maintenance and to ensure reliable connections for long-term applications. They also provide protection against overloaded circuits, short circuits, and back-feeding, which can be hazardous. Barrier blocks are commonly used in applications such as signal processing, testing/measuring, electronic assembly, and transformer windings.

Terminal blocks and barrier blocks have the same basic working principle: providing a secure physical barrier to separate and protect the electrical current of two or more points while transferring the electrical current from one point to another. The working principle of both types of electrical interconnection systems also includes the placement of a barrier between the two connection points, such as plastic, rubber, or ceramic, for insulation. This reduces the likelihood of direct contact between the two connection points, which could cause an electric shock or spark.

To put it simply, the working principle of terminal blocks and barrier blocks provide a reliable and safe environment for the distribution of electricity. They provide the necessary insulation as well as a secure connection for the efficient transfer of electricity. Terminals blocks and barrier blocks are highly beneficial in environments where the transfer of electricity is frequent or continual, such as industrial, commercial, and residential settings.
